Originations Soar at Citi
$31.9 billion Q2 fundings
July 31, 2009 (updated Aug 5)
By MortgageDaily.com staff
|
|
Quarterly home loan production jumped more than 40 percent at Citigroup Inc.
Second-quarter residential originations were $31.9 billion, according to data reported to MortgageDaily.com today by the New York-based company. (a Citigroup spokesman subsequently issued a statement indicating that production was revised down to $31.3 billion)
Production jumped from $22.4 billion reported for the first quarter based on prior earnings data. During the second-quarter 2008, volume was $28.5 billion.
The report also indicated that the residential servicing portfolio was $767.5 billion as of June 30, down from $783.8 billion three months earlier and $855.5 billion 12 months earlier.
The latest total included $186.3 billion in loans owned by Citi and $581.2 billion in mortgages serviced for others.
Citi previously reported 6.52 percent residential delinquency of at least 90 days as of the end of the second quarter at subsidiary Citi Holdings, which includes CitiMortgage and CitiFinancial.
Earnings at Citigroup improved to $1.4 billion from a $5.3 billion loss recorded in the first quarter. |
